Æ25 - Trajan ΘΕΑ ΡΩΜΗ ΚΑΙ ΘΕΩ ϹΕΒΑϹΤΩ

Features

Issuer City of Pergamum (Conventus of Pergamum)
Emperor Trajan (Marcus Ulpius Traianus) (98-117)
Type Standard circulation coins
Years 113-114
Composition Bronze
Weight 9.65 g
Diameter 25 mm
Shape Round (irregular)
Technique Hammered

Obverse

Temple with four columns on podium with three steps within which Zeus Philios seated left, holding patera in right hand, left resting on sceptre, and Trajan standing right in front of Zeus, in military dress, his left resting on spear

Lettering: ΑΥΤ ΤΡΑΙΑΝΟ ϹΕΒ ΠΕΡ(Γ) ΦΙΛΙΟϹ ΖΕΥϹ

Unabridged legend: Αὐτοκράτωρ Τραϊανὸς Σεβαστὸς Περγαμηνῶν Φίλιος Ζεὺς

Translation: Emperor Trajan Augustus, of the Pergamenes, Zeus Philios

Reverse

Temple with four columns of Rome and Augustus on podium with three steps within which Roma standing facing, her head turned right, crowning Augustus with right hand and holding cornucopia in left, and Augustus standing facing, his head turned right, in military dress, his left resting on spear

Lettering: ΘΕΑ ΡΩΜΗ ΚΑΙ ΘΕΩ ϹΕΒΑϹΤΩ

Translation: to the goddess Roma and to the divine Augustus

Mint

Pergamum, Mysia, modern-day Bergama, Turkey
